Anchorage, Alaska (AP) — A 41-year-old Craig man will serve more than three years in prison for violating the Lacey and the Marine Mammal Protection acts. Christopher R. Rowland was also fined $5,000 when he was sentenced in U.S. District Court in Anchorage. Authorities say he was extensively involved in the illegal hunting, killing and […]
